MELBOURNE – JAPANTHER

Japanther is the beast of a band consisting of Matt Reilly and Ian Vanek. Over three years ago we described them as sounding as though “Iron Maiden, Throbbing Gristle and Lightning Bolt gave birth to a squealing little baby with flaming guitars for arms” and we’re really pleased to report that they haven’t toned down a bit. They are about to head to Australia for some more shows and countless apple bongs.

Vice: Hey Japanther, what have you been up to since you were in Australia for the Vice parties last time?
In the two years since we’ve seen your shores Japanther has been mighty busy. We’ve been a part of writing two puppet rock operas “Don’t Trust Anyone Over Thirty” with Dan Graham and “Dump The Body In Rikki Lake” of our own device. We also wrote and performed water ballet with Olympic sycronized swimmer Lauren McFall and Auquadoom in April of 2006. We’ve released a couple EPs, toured Europe, Canada and the US several times each and now we are getting ready to release our new full length album “Skuffed Up My Huffy” with EXO records in Melbourne.

There’s a nice contrast in your music between how erratic and insane it is sometimes and how melodic and calming it is at others. What’s with that?
Life consists of peaks and valleys, our music often times reflects that.

When you were in Australia last time, a few public telephones became victim to your stage show. Do you still use old telephone mouthpieces as microphones and have you developed any new techniques since?
Let me clarify that y’all have some sticky fingers in Melbourne. Two tours ago (the Vice tour) a sweet little girl stole our phones right off the stage after the show. This forced our animal to adapt and cut a few weird Aussie square phones. Her friends returned it later with a note on it that blamed booze. Then we met Her on July 4th in Brooklyn. She was sheepish but nice! HAHA… We are exploring new avenues daily, but yes we are still screaming into payphones.

Matt, last time you guys were here, it was hard to focus on anything but your enormous afro. How’s that going?
I had to switch it up and cut that beast, too many people recognizing me on the street. It’s coming back in nicely though.

The artwork for your album covers, t-shirts and other paraphernalia is consistently incredible. Do you do that yourself?
We try our best to be a self-sufficient unit, this includes logo design, shirt screening, tour booking, etc.
